Understanding Plastic Compounding and Its Industrial Importance
Plastic compounding involves blending base polymers with multiple additives to deliver desired results. These may include impact resistance, colour uniformity, or chemical stability. The resulting compound finds application across diverse processing methods.
This allows manufacturers to boost functionality, lower production costs, and meet specific usage environments. As the shift toward sustainable, efficient, and performance-based materials continues, expert polymer compounders become key players.

Why ABS Compounds Are Industry Favourites
ABS (Acrylonitrile Butadiene Styrene) is widely preferred for its impact resistance, ideal for high-impact applications. Its balance of mechanical properties makes it perfect for a wide spectrum of commercial items.
Manufacturers often enhance it with glass fibre or additives, offering tailored performance.
PC ABS Compound: Strength Meets Style
PC ABS (Polycarbonate blended with ABS) delivers high impact strength and a polished finish. It is popular across automotive interiors, consumer gadgets, and medical equipment.
With enhanced surface quality and thermal tolerance, PC ABS is perfect for both aesthetic and structural functions.
PP Compounds: Lightweight and Efficient
Polypropylene (PP) offers excellent chemical resistance and low weight. Through compounding, PP becomes more rigid, thermally resistant, and durable.
Talc filled PP manufacturers cater to automotive, home, and industrial needs, ensuring enhanced dimensional control in plastic parts.
Functional Additives through Masterbatch Solutions
Masterbatches are pre-mixed blends designed to add colour or function, integrated into base resins for extra functionality.
They simplify processing, while maintaining base resin integrity.
Why Industries Choose PBT and PET Compounds
PBT and PET excel in precision parts for electronics and vehicles. These materials adapt well to insulation, sensors, and enclosures.
They are ideal for automotive and electrical connectors, offering enduring strength under load.
Custom Polypropylene Solutions with Talc Reinforcement
Talc filled polypropylene improves stiffness at an affordable cost. Used in trims, consoles, and panels, these compounds combine strength and cost-efficiency.
Developers fine-tune blends, balancing environmental sustainability and material performance.
Nylon 6 6 – High-Strength Engineering Plastic
Nylon 6 6 is ideal for high-load, high-heat settings. Often reinforced with glass or minerals, it is a go-to material for automotive gears, bushings, and brackets.
It handles abrasion and high stress reliably, including connectors, gear housings, and mechanical systems.
